What is White Discharge During Pregnancy?
White discharge during pregnancy, medically known as leukorrhea in pregnancy, is a thin, milky fluid produced by the vagina. During pregnancy, hormonal changes—especially increased estrogen—cause this discharge to increase.
It helps keep the vagina clean and protects the developing baby from infections.
It is usually:
- White or off-white
- Mild-smelling or odorless
- Thin or slightly thick
This is the body’s natural way of protecting the birth canal from infections and is considered one of the early pregnancy symptoms.

When Should You Be Concerned?
While white discharge during pregnancy is normal, watch for:
- Yellow/green color
- Foul smell
- Itching or burning
- Thick or clumpy texture
- Blood presence
These are not typical early pregnancy symptoms and need medical attention.
Tips for Managing White Discharge
- Maintain proper hygiene
- Wear cotton underwear
- Stay hydrated
- Eat a balanced diet
- Avoid scented products

Q1. Is it normal to have white discharge while pregnant?
Yes, white discharge during pregnancy is completely normal and healthy.
Q2. What week does white milky discharge start in pregnancy?
It can begin in the first trimester and is considered one of the earliest pregnancy symptoms.
Q3. Can white discharge be a miscarriage?
No, normal leukorrhea in pregnancy is not linked to miscarriage. However, consult a doctor if there is bleeding.
